Commit Graph

41091 Commits

Author SHA1 Message Date
DanielRosa74
581a488bc8
feat(curriculum): Add speaking practices to B1 English (#66376) 2026-03-11 17:36:22 -03:00
Oliver Eyton-Williams
9aa6f05fa1
fix(client): duplicate console output (#66350) 2026-03-11 21:15:50 +01:00
Oliver Eyton-Williams
b72d31c209
refactor(client): source superblock intros from curriculum (#66328) 2026-03-11 08:53:10 -07:00
Huyen Nguyen
e8052b52c2
fix: race condition in concurrent delete user requests test (#66362)
Co-authored-by: Oliver Eyton-Williams <ojeytonwilliams@gmail.com>
2026-03-11 13:10:43 +00:00
freeCodeCamp's Camper Bot
5d19e0d009
chore(i18n,client): processed translations (#66372) 2026-03-11 20:05:05 +07:00
Jeevankumar S
5b9c2516a4
fix(package): exclude transform-spread from babel preset-env to preserve native spread behavior (#66363) 2026-03-11 12:44:13 +01:00
Huyen Nguyen
f10df73594
fix(challenge-helper-scripts): auto-derive help category from challenge lang (#66356) 2026-03-11 12:17:18 +01:00
Fernando Belmonte Archetti
8ed4646b51
fix(curriculum): css specificity internal external descriptions (#66349)
Co-authored-by: majestic-owl448 <26656284+majestic-owl448@users.noreply.github.com>
2026-03-11 17:54:01 +07:00
Tom
79eea990ea
feat(curriculum): daily challenges 223-229 (#66313)
Some checks failed
i18n - Build Validation / Validate i18n Builds (24) (push) Has been cancelled
CI - Node.js / Lint (24) (push) Has been cancelled
CI - Node.js / Build (24) (push) Has been cancelled
CI - Node.js / Test (24) (push) Has been cancelled
CI - Node.js / Test - Upcoming Changes (24) (push) Has been cancelled
CI - Node.js / Test - i18n (italian, 24) (push) Has been cancelled
CI - Node.js / Test - i18n (portuguese, 24) (push) Has been cancelled
i18n - Upload Client UI / Client (push) Has been cancelled
i18n - Upload Curriculum / Learn (push) Has been cancelled
CD - Docker - DOCR Cleanup Container Images / Delete Old Images (learn-api, dev) (push) Has been cancelled
CD - Docker - DOCR Cleanup Container Images / Delete Old Images (learn-api, org) (push) Has been cancelled
2026-03-11 10:12:51 +01:00
Tom
a1c5e08728
fix(tests): disable dc e2e tests (#66357) 2026-03-11 05:31:53 +07:00
Rafael D. Hernandez
9362039fce
feat: Added mp3 audio file name for what each department does (#66353)
Co-authored-by: Huyen Nguyen <25715018+huyenltnguyen@users.noreply.github.com>
2026-03-11 04:16:57 +07:00
Julien Desbard
bac47051e4
fix(curriculum): updated verb tense (#66351) 2026-03-10 17:33:54 +00:00
Hillary Nyakundi
29979ca3a4
feat(curriculum): add linked list operations lab (#65448)
Co-authored-by: Ilenia M <nethleen@gmail.com>
Co-authored-by: majestic-owl448 <26656284+majestic-owl448@users.noreply.github.com>
2026-03-10 17:01:55 +00:00
Jessica Wilkins
521c221276
fix: incomplete html and css course names for catalog (#66316)
Co-authored-by: Huyen Nguyen <25715018+huyenltnguyen@users.noreply.github.com>
2026-03-10 16:29:30 +00:00
majestic-owl448
d444cc0cb7
fix(curriculum): add opposite parameter validation tests (#66296) 2026-03-10 10:33:23 -05:00
Oliver Eyton-Williams
66c9c7913f
Revert "fix(client): avoid redundant updateFile dispatch on load when files are unchanged" (#66345) 2026-03-10 16:19:29 +01:00
majestic-owl448
bd767988e4
fix(curriculum): reorder intros for superblock responsive-web-design-v9 (#66295) 2026-03-10 09:48:17 -05:00
majestic-owl448
7302c9b965
fix(curriculum): reorder intros for superblock relational-databases-v9 (#66294) 2026-03-10 09:47:10 -05:00
majestic-owl448
86f34c557a
fix(curriculum): reorder intros for superblock python-v9 (#66293) 2026-03-10 09:45:54 -05:00
majestic-owl448
1ad17425aa
fix(curriculum): reorder intros for superblock back-end-development-and-apis-v9 (#66292) 2026-03-10 09:45:01 -05:00
majestic-owl448
40a1339b8c
fix(curriculum): reorder intros for superblock front-end-development-libraries-v9 (#66291) 2026-03-10 09:43:23 -05:00
majestic-owl448
512172de1e
fix(curriculum): reorder intros for superblock javascript-v9 (#66290) 2026-03-10 09:40:46 -05:00
leputz
d4161819cc
fix(client) downloaded daily code challenge solution with filename (#64385) 2026-03-10 09:15:37 -05:00
Sem Bauke
8c3a89113a
fix(client): avoid redundant updateFile dispatch on load when files are unchanged (#66326) 2026-03-10 13:51:26 +00:00
harirs139-ui
0e25761399
fix(curriculum): enforce recursion in Build a Countdown challenge (#66266) 2026-03-10 19:30:24 +07:00
Jeevankumar S
316b3b02ce
refactor(curriculum): remove challenge caching (#66297) 2026-03-10 09:49:51 +01:00
Oliver Eyton-Williams
fcdf03fe33
fix(tools): improve curriculum build, but with correct caching (#66323) 2026-03-10 09:32:50 +01:00
Jessica Wilkins
ecceedbbb6
feat: Add interactive rdbs courses to catalog (#66218) 2026-03-10 10:14:40 +03:00
Mrugesh Mohapatra
fba37af181
revert: remove unnecessary tsc call (#66322)
Some checks failed
CI - E2E - 3rd party donation tests / Build Client (24) (push) Has been cancelled
CI - E2E - 3rd party donation tests / Build API (Container) (push) Has been cancelled
CI - Node.js / Lint (24) (push) Has been cancelled
CI - E2E - 3rd party donation tests / Run Playwright 3rd Party Donation Tests (chromium, 24) (push) Has been cancelled
CI - Node.js / Build (24) (push) Has been cancelled
CI - Node.js / Test (24) (push) Has been cancelled
CI - Node.js / Test - Upcoming Changes (24) (push) Has been cancelled
CI - Node.js / Test - i18n (italian, 24) (push) Has been cancelled
CI - Node.js / Test - i18n (portuguese, 24) (push) Has been cancelled
2026-03-10 11:13:14 +05:30
Supravisor
5eea0731aa
fix(curriculum): guaranteed typo in daily challenge (#66307) 2026-03-10 10:55:51 +05:30
Oliver Eyton-Williams
96f80a6493
perf: remove unnecessary tsc call (#66311) 2026-03-10 09:45:04 +05:30
renovate[bot]
eb30d67f1a
chore(deps): update actions/setup-node action to v6.3.0 (#66318)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-10 08:37:05 +05:30
freeCodeCamp's Camper Bot
9970e4dacb
chore(i18n,learn): update i18n-curriculum submodule (#66314) 2026-03-09 17:35:23 +01:00
freeCodeCamp's Camper Bot
072cc4bdab
chore(i18n,client): processed translations (#66312) 2026-03-09 16:51:49 +01:00
Kolade Chris
87edde16fe
feat(curriculum): add dsa review to js v9 cert (#66009)
Co-authored-by: Zaira <33151350+zairahira@users.noreply.github.com>
Co-authored-by: majestic-owl448 <26656284+majestic-owl448@users.noreply.github.com>
Co-authored-by: Kiruthika R <146549751+kiruthikadev-r@users.noreply.github.com>
2026-03-09 12:59:46 +00:00
Hillary Nyakundi
08954857c7
feat(curriculum): add queue data structure lab (#66269) 2026-03-09 17:13:41 +05:30
Ahmad Abdolsaheb
4ea5ae56cb
feat: add independent lowerjaw in labs (#65785) 2026-03-09 14:38:31 +03:00
Aditya Singh
7510f608c3
fix(curriculum): update example codes in js classes review (#66158)
Co-authored-by: Huyen Nguyen <25715018+huyenltnguyen@users.noreply.github.com>
Co-authored-by: Jeevankumar S <110320697+Jeevankumar-s@users.noreply.github.com>
2026-03-09 00:16:21 +05:30
Oliver Eyton-Williams
f1717edae5
refactor: move static curriculum data out of redux (#66214)
Some checks failed
CD - Docker - GHCR Images / Build and Push Images (push) Has been cancelled
i18n - Build Validation / Validate i18n Builds (24) (push) Has been cancelled
CI - Node.js / Lint (24) (push) Has been cancelled
CI - Node.js / Build (24) (push) Has been cancelled
CI - Node.js / Test (24) (push) Has been cancelled
CI - Node.js / Test - Upcoming Changes (24) (push) Has been cancelled
CI - Node.js / Test - i18n (italian, 24) (push) Has been cancelled
CI - Node.js / Test - i18n (portuguese, 24) (push) Has been cancelled
i18n - Download Client UI / Client (push) Has been cancelled
CD - Docker - DOCR Cleanup Container Images / Delete Old Images (learn-api, dev) (push) Has been cancelled
CD - Docker - DOCR Cleanup Container Images / Delete Old Images (learn-api, org) (push) Has been cancelled
2026-03-07 17:41:46 +02:00
Aditya Singh
0480bb91b7
fix(curriculum): update example codes for set and tuple (#66282) 2026-03-07 12:52:27 +01:00
renovate[bot]
5145285c5a
chore(deps): update dependency @types/node to v24.11.0 (#66279)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-07 16:35:04 +05:30
Aditya Singh
c95d4a87e0
fix(curriculum): add brief explanation for decorators in getters and setters lesson (#65888)
Co-authored-by: Dario <105294544+Dario-DC@users.noreply.github.com>
2026-03-07 11:19:08 +01:00
renovate[bot]
48e86c5399
fix(deps): update dependency @aws-sdk/client-ses to v3.1000.0 (#66263)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-07 13:38:33 +05:30
renovate[bot]
837e34f544
chore(deps): update dependency eslint to v9.39.3 (#66254)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-07 12:17:23 +05:30
renovate[bot]
5533b5b3eb
chore(deps): update dependency @types/node to v24.10.15 (#66262)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2026-03-07 08:47:08 +05:30
majestic-owl448
ac6973f001
feat(curriculum): add html music player workshop (#65825)
Co-authored-by: Jeevankumar S <110320697+Jeevankumar-s@users.noreply.github.com>
Co-authored-by: Dario <105294544+Dario-DC@users.noreply.github.com>
Co-authored-by: Sem Bauke <sem@freecodecamp.org>
2026-03-06 19:15:08 +01:00
Anastasiia
344c3fa699
feat(curriculum): EN-B1 quiz for block 8 (#66270) 2026-03-06 15:12:45 +00:00
freeCodeCamp's Camper Bot
cff6065df2
chore(i18n,learn): update i18n-curriculum submodule (#66272) 2026-03-06 15:53:22 +01:00
freeCodeCamp's Camper Bot
5b64ff3c7c
chore(i18n,learn): update i18n-curriculum submodule (#66271) 2026-03-06 14:28:35 +01:00
Aditya Singh
84ba45ec6e
fix(curriculum): improve test for step-75 workshop city skyline (#66001)
Co-authored-by: majestic-owl448 <26656284+majestic-owl448@users.noreply.github.com>
2026-03-06 18:34:07 +05:30